The veleco quicker is a top four-wheeled scooter with extra stability. This is a major improvement over the 3 wheeled scooters you see on the market. The additional wheel provides the scooter with more stability and lets it be used for longer trips without having to charge the battery often.

This scooter is great for those who wish to drive the highway. However, it's important to note that class 3 invalid carriages cannot be used on the sidewalk or bus lanes. Additionally, they shouldn't be used on motorways or dual carriageways with speed limits above 50mph. These scooters should be driven on the left-hand side of the road and parked in a location that does not block pedestrian access to other areas. Contact a knowledgeable mobility scooter retailer for advice if you are unsure where to park. They can direct you to the best parking spot.

veleco-zt16-3-wheeled-mobility-scooter-fully-assembled-and-ready-to-use-big-wheels-easy-to-manoeuvre-front-and-rear-brakes-removable-shopping-basket-red-219.jpgIf you're considering buying a mobility device, you might want to think about insurance. Although it's not a legal obligation, it's an excellent idea to ensure your own security as well as the safety of others. The cost of insurance depends on your location and the value of your scooter, as well as the specifics of your life. Certain insurance companies also offer training courses to help you learn how to drive your scooter safely and with confidence.
